Output dd24a57027ecaf60edcd62a6a14873926730f5ed2fbfc2228ab4ca39c0113413:1

value
1063552
script pubkey
OP_0 OP_PUSHBYTES_20 12d155b4c346b12ccec0cb682d8bc8179e33335c
address
ltc1qztg4tdxrg6cjenkqed5zmz7gz70rxv6uxuafkh
transaction
dd24a57027ecaf60edcd62a6a14873926730f5ed2fbfc2228ab4ca39c0113413
spent
true